What is being bought
Scottish Canals will be issuing a tender in respect of establishing a framework for the provision of recruitment services for an initial 2 year period with an option to extend for up to a further 2 years.
Scottish Canals is the public organisation responsible for the management of 220 kilometres of inland waterways in the Highlands and Lowlands of Scotland.
This framework will include 9 lots each relating to a particular recruitment specialism with the intention to appoint 3 agencies ranked within each lot. Awards will be made based on supplier rank and availability within each lot as and when a recruitment requirement is established.
Suppliers may bid for all lots or on an individual lot basis.
